Ferry and Medieval Market in Rumpenheim

Hi Mommy,

sorry I have not written for so long, but we were so busy going all over the place that we all were much too tired to write.  ;)

Today, Anja took us to the medieval market in Rumpenheim.

Anja always grins when she hears the word "Rumpenheim".
Long ago, she told us, when the movie "Titanic" was playing in the movie theaters, the Frankfurt radio station published a spoof on "Titanic", a "heart rending" mini series called "the sinking of the river Main ferry at Rumpenheim", describing in many catching episodes (with the captain and the passengers speaking Hessian dialect) how the river Main ferry at Rumpenheim sank in the 3 meters deep icy waters of the Main river.  :p

Well, we got to see and even ride this famous (  ;) ) ferry today!
